RiverPark Advisors LLC lifted its position in Netflix, Inc. (NASDAQ:NFLX - Free Report) by 32.3%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 4,867 shares of the Internet television network's stock after buying an additional 1,188 shares during the period. Netflix makes up 3.1% of RiverPark Advisors LLC's holdings, making the stock its 8th largest position. RiverPark Advisors LLC's holdings in Netflix were worth $4,338,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Netflix Stock Up 0.9 %
NASDAQ NFLX opened at $1,049.94 on Thursday. Netflix, Inc. has a twelve month low of $544.25 and a twelve month high of $1,064.97. The stock has a market cap of $449.12 billion, a PE ratio of 52.95, a PEG ratio of 2.12 and a beta of 1.55. The firm has a 50-day simple moving average of $953.84 and a 200 day simple moving average of $898.31.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.56, a quick ratio of 1.22 and a current ratio of 1.22.
Netflix (NASDAQ:NFLX -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 17th. The Internet television network reported $6.61 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$5.74 by $0.87. The company had revenue of $10.54 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$10.51 billion. Netflix had a return on equity of 38.32% and a net margin of 22.34%.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$8.28 EPS. On average, research analysts forecast that Netflix, Inc. will post 24.58 EPS for the current year.

About Netflix
(
Free Report)
Netflix, Inc provides entertainment services. It offers TV series, documentaries, feature films, and games across various genres and languages. The company also provides members the ability to receive streaming content through a host of internet-connected devices, including TVs, digital video players, TV set-top boxes, and mobile devices.
